A CHANCE to see original artwork by city students is on offer at the University of Worcester later this month.
The Arts Degree Show is an annual event where students showcase their work and is a celebration of their time at the University’s School of Arts.
The week-long event will get under way on Friday, May 24 at the University’s Art House on Castle Street.
This follows the opening night of the Degree Show the evening before when the student’s family and friends will come together with industry professionals to see the work on display from students.
The show will feature work from across a variety of disciplines including animation, illustration, graphic design and fine art.
The Art House will be open between 10am and 4pm during the week following opening night.
The University’s Head of the School of Arts, David Broster said: “This is first and foremost a celebration of the students’ work.
“It is not austere, or formal, and is an opportunity for friends, family and the public to come in, have a look around and enjoy the work.
“For the students, this is the culmination of all the years spent developing ideas and techniques and the chance to showcase their finished work.”
“It’s a key moment for the artists, they’ve worked hard over the years building to this and it is a significant step up for everyone when the work is viewed and commented on by the public and professionals.”
